I knew when Maggie passed that her little sister needed a companion.  I adopted a pug boy, Obie, who was 4 at the time.  I didn't think Tani or I could handle a puppy!

I will say that in those first few months having two black pugs again, but Mag not being there was sometimes hard.  In some ways I think it made me miss her more.  I often found myself saying 'Maggie never did that' or 'Maggie learned that much faster'.  But as I came to accept her loss I was able to accept Obie on his own.

And after 10 years of calling the pack 'the girls' we find ourselves still doing it with Tani and Obie.  It's Ok though- Obie is not the manliest of pugs big-grin.
